Opublikuj swoje zlecenie za darmo i otrzymaj oferty od wykonawców freelancerów już minutę po opublikowaniu!
Laboratorium programowania systemowego
Zlecenie jest tłumaczone automatycznie. Zaloguj się lub zarejestruj się, żeby zobaczyć oryginał
1)
Styl klasy: zakaz "zamknięcia" komendy w menu systemowym; wysłać wiadomość do procedury okiennej przy podwójnym naciśnięciu, ponowne malowanie okna przy zmianie rozmiaru pionowego.Typ ikony: IDI_ QUESTION.Typ kursora: IDC_CROSSKolor tła okna: biały.Nazwa klasy okna: nazwa studenta (w języku angielskim).Styl okna: okno ma tytuł i ramy; okno ma przycisk minimalizacji i menu systemowe; tworzy się najpierw okno minimalizowane.Pozycja okna: w centrum ekranu o szerokości 220 i wysokości 150 punktów.W menu programu przewiduje wymianę kursora, ikon, tła okna i tytułu.Program powinien zawierać menu, w którym znajduje się punkt „O programie”, wybierając, który, wywołuje okno dialogowe z informacjami o uczniach.Okno dialogowe powinno zawierać 3 przyciski: „OK”, „Zamknij”, „Więcej szczegółów”.Kiedy naciśniesz przycisk zamknięcia programu, użytkownik musi wyświetlić okno z prośbą o potwierdzenie zamknięcia, które będzie zawierać tekst „Czy jesteś pewien?” i 2 przyciski: „Tak, zamknij wszystko” i „Nie, kontynuuj pracę”.Naciśnięcie przycisku „Tak, zamknij wszystko” powinno doprowadzić do zamknięcia programu.2)
Wpisz program, który wyświetla w wolnych współrzędnych okien programu liczby, na przykład 20 liczb.Podczas wprowadzania tekstu z klawiatury liczby parowe są zastąpione wprowadzonym symbolem.Jeśli liczba wprowadzonych znaków przekroczyła liczbę liczb parowych - wyodrębnienie odbywa się za liczbami nieparowymi.Jeśli liczba wprowadzonych znaków przekroczyła liczbę liczb - powiadomić użytkownika.Realizuj następujące informacje: - informacje o metrykę: wielkość kąt, w którym jest obliczona podwójna klatka myszy, wysokość i szerokość kursora; - informacje o urządzeniu: szerokość strzału na linii horyzontalnej skręcania; - informacje o czcionce: wysokość czcionki, wielkość interwaru międzyczasowego
3)
Napisz program, który wypełnia całą powierzchnię klienta oknem kwadratami o rozmiarze 10x10 pikseli.Każdy kwadrat ma swój kolor, który zmienia się od czerwonego w prawym górnym rogu do żółtego w lewym dolnym rogu.Każdy kwadrat zawiera literę alfabetu, kolory liter są wybierane przypadkowo.Dodaj do menu programu funkcję "Randomizacja", podczas której kwadraty poruszają się w polu przypadkowo, przechowując na nich pisane litery, a każdy kwadrat kątowy przekształca się w malowaną gwiazdę.Wszystkie kwadraty, wartości trzech kolorów, które w sumie dzielą się na 5, stają się czarne.4)
Stwórz okno listy (listbox), które zawiera listę nazw wszystkich członków brigady.Wybierając każdą z nich (podwójne kliknięcie myszy) w obszarze klienta okna są tworzone wszystkie możliwe okna zależne, które zawierają tekst (kliknięte przyciski, wskaźniki, przełączniki, okna edycji, okna statyczne), w których tekst zawiera wybrane nazwisko.Horizontalne i pionowe paski skręcania pozwalają przenosić wszystkie wyżej zakręcone okna do wnętrza obszaru klienta okna.
Załączniki 1
Wgląd do aplikacji jest dostępny tylko zarejestrowanym użytkownikom.